The Electrical Test Technician I is expected to perform system tests, conform to production and quality standards, analyze failure modes, and perform minor repairs in workstation. The tester ensures all records are kept and confers with appropriate resources when issues arise.
Responsibilities:
Comply with the company and site safety and quality policies, processes, and procedures
Maintain clean work environment and comply with 5S standards
Follow and complete established procedures, processes, and policies
Use standard work, programs, and work instructions to test all products, models, and/or subassemblies
Interpret schematics and drawings to properly test all products
Low/Medium Voltage Testing: Perform preliminary and low-voltage electrical tests (up to 10KV) in both manufacturing and test floor environments. This suite of tests encompasses Doble, Hipot, resistance, DGA, CT Test
Develop/co-develop written test procedures and/or troubleshooting guides for other technicians/testers
Troubleshoot and document all product, models, and/or subassemblies appropriately to meet quality standards
Perform minor repairs per work instruction/standard work within takt time; refer major repairs to appropriate resources
Collaborate on improving processes, lead times, productivity and cost using the DTZ process
Obtain and renew safety certification as needed to properly move and/or test all products, models, and/or subassemblies
Inform maintenance team of preventative maintenance opportunities for test equipment
Program systems on the product to perform testing as needed
Demonstrate an advanced technical aptitude to perform testing for complex, infrequent, and variable products
Work on assignments beyond product testing, participating in CI or NPI related initiatives
Work with Engineering to enhance test procedures
Act as a technical expert on product test, quality, and process issues with other areas
Minimum Qualifications:
Associate's degree in Power, High Voltage, Electrical Engineering, Utilities Engineering, Electro-magnetic/equivalent major or 2 years' experience with Transformer Factory Acceptance Testing or Field Commissioning Testing.
NFP70E Medium Voltage certification & NEC Training (achieved within 30 days of start in role prior to beginning electrical work)
2 years of product testing in a manufacturing environment.
